Embodiment 1
[0086] The present embodiment provides a kind of cultivation method of leafy vegetables, specifically comprises the following steps:
[0087] S1: Sowing, sowing in the seedling sponge to germinate the lettuce seeds. Wherein, the seedling-raising sponge is a water-soaked sponge, and there are multiple breeding holes in the seedling-raising sponge, and a lettuce seed is sown in each breeding hole.
[0088] Specifically, the seedling raising sponge can be placed in the seedling raising tray, and a transparent protective cover or protective film can be covered on the seedling raising tray.
[0089] In some cases, irradiation treatments with artificial light sources were used to germinate the lettuce seeds in the nursery sponges.

Embodiment 2
[0107] This embodiment provides a method for cultivating leafy vegetables. The specific steps and part of the cultivating conditions of the cultivating method are similar to the above-mentioned embodiment 1, and will not be repeated here. The differences between this embodiment and embodiment 1 are introduced below ,details as follows:
[0108]In this embodiment, an LED light source is provided as an artificial light source, the frequency of the light source is set to 10MHz by chopping, and the duty cycle is 60%, 50%, 40% and 20% of the lighting conditions, and the other test conditions are almost the same. Carry out the seedling cultivation of lettuce, and obtain the lettuce plants corresponding to each condition respectively.
[0109] It should be noted that this embodiment also provides a DC panel LED light source (50 Hz, continuous light) without chopping processing as a DC condition control group. For specific test conditions, please refer to Table 2 below.

Embodiment 3
[0117] This embodiment provides a method for cultivating leafy vegetables. The specific steps and part of the cultivating conditions of the cultivating method are similar to the above-mentioned embodiment 1, and will not be repeated here. The differences between this embodiment and embodiment 1 are introduced below ,details as follows:
[0118] In this embodiment, an LED light source is provided as an artificial light source, and the frequency of the light source is set to 100KHz, 1MHz, 2MHz, 5MHz, 7MHz, 10MHz and 15MHz by chopping, and the duty cycle is 40%. The seedling cultivation of lettuce is carried out under the same conditions, and the lettuce plants corresponding to each condition are respectively obtained.
[0119] It should be noted that this embodiment also provides a DC panel LED light source (50 Hz, continuous light) without chopping processing as a DC condition control group. For specific test conditions, please refer to Table 3 below.
